通配符证书怎么配置

发布日期: 2024-12-23

本文介绍了通配符证书的概念、重要性以及如何在服务器上配置通配符证书,以确保多个子域名的安全通信。


通配符证书怎么配置

本文总体约600字,阅读需要大概2分钟 在网络安全领域,SSL/TLS证书是确保数据传输安全的重要工具。通配符证书是一种特殊的SSL/TLS证书,它允许一个证书保护一个主域名及其所有子域名。这对于拥有多个子域名的企业来说非常有用,因为它可以简化证书管理并降低成本。本文将详细介绍通配符证书的概念、重要性以及如何在服务器上进行配置。 **通配符证书的概念** 通配符证书是一种SSL/TLS证书,它使用通配符(*)来表示一个域名下的所有子域名。例如,如果你有一个名为example.com的主域名,使用通配符证书可以保护如mail.example.com、shop.example.com等所有子域名。这种证书自2015年起由Let's Encrypt等证书颁发机构提供。 **通配符证书的重要性** 1. **成本效益**:对于拥有多个子域名的企业来说,使用通配符证书可以避免为每个子域名单独购买证书,从而节省成本。 2. **管理简化**:通配符证书简化了证书管理流程,因为只需要更新和维护一个证书。 3. **安全性**:确保所有子域名都受到SSL/TLS保护,增强了整个网站的安全性。 **配置通配符证书的步骤** 1. **选择证书颁发机构**:选择一个提供通配符证书的证书颁发机构,如Let's Encrypt。 2. **域名验证**:在申请通配符证书时,证书颁发机构会要求验证你的域名所有权。这通常通过DNS记录或文件上传等方式完成。 3. **安装证书**:一旦证书颁发机构验证了你的域名并颁发了证书,你需要将证书安装到你的服务器上。这通常包括证书文件(.crt或.pem)、私钥(.key)和可能的中间证书(CA链)。 4. **配置服务器**:根据你的服务器类型(如Apache、Nginx等),你需要在服务器配置文件中指定证书文件的位置,并确保服务器使用这些证书来加密通信。 5. **测试配置**:配置完成后,使用SSL检查工具如SSL Labs的SSL Server Test来测试你的配置是否正确,确保所有子域名都正确地使用了通配符证书。 6. **监控和更新**:定期监控证书的有效期,并在证书到期前更新,以保持网站的安全。 **注意事项** - 在配置过程中,确保私钥的安全,不要泄露给未经授权的人员。 - 通配符证书不支持多级子域名,例如sub.sub.example.com。如果需要支持多级子域名,可能需要单独为每个级别申请证书。 - 某些旧版本的浏览器和操作系统可能不支持通配符证书,因此在部署前应进行兼容性测试。 总结来说,通配符证书是一种高效且经济的方式来保护一个主域名及其所有子域名的安全。通过遵循上述步骤,你可以在你的服务器上成功配置通配符证书,确保数据传输的安全。 感谢您阅读完本文,请对我们的内容予以点评,以帮助我们提升